Title: Study on relationship between expressions of Livin protein and apoptosis related protein Bcl-2 and lung cancer
Abstract: Objective
To explore the relationship between the abnormal expressions of Livin protein and apoptosis related protein Bcl-2 and lung cancer.
Methods
The clinical data of patients with lung cancer treated in our hospital from June 2014 to August 2016 were retrospectively analyzed.At the same time, the data of non lung cancer patients confirmed by pathological examination were selected as control.The expressions of Livin protein and apoptosis related protein Bcl-2 in two groups were compared.The expressions of Livin protein and apoptosis related protein Bcl-2 in lung cancer patients with different clinical and pathological features were compared.The factors affecting the expression rate of Livin and Bcl-2 in lung cancer patients were analyzed.
Results
The positive expression rates of Livin and Bcl-2 in lung cancer group were 61.11%, 65.56%, which were higher than those in control group (χ2=110.604, 112.855, all P<0.001). The expressions of Livin and Bcl-2 in lung cancer patients with stage Ⅲ+ Ⅳ, lymph node metastasis, squamous cell carcinoma, low differentiation and tumor size greater than 3 cm were higher.The multivariate logistic regression analysis showed that lymph node metastasis, TNM stage and histological type were the influencing factors of the positive expression rate of Livin and Bcl-2 in lung cancer patients.Correlation analysis showed that the positive expression rate of Bcl-2 was positively correlated with that of Livin protein in lung cancer patients (r=0.521, P<0.001).
Conclusions
The positive expression rates of Livin and Bcl-2 in lung cancer patients are higher, and they are closely related to the lymph node metastasis, TNM stage and histological type.
